Martin v. Löwis added the comment:
I'm unsure. I'd rather stick to the established policy. If there are reasons to change the policy, I'd like to know what they are and what a new policy should look like, instead of making a singular exception from the policy.
For the record, the reason *for* the policy is that it reduces maintenance burden; I'm unsure whether I still have the environment to build Python 3.2, for example.
